What to Eat in Donghae? "Taste Map" with Representative Foods Created

On the 24th, Donghae City in Gangwon announced that it had produced and distributed a "Taste Map of Donghae, Where to Eat" to promote the local economy and food culture. This taste map is designed to help tourists and citizens easily access Donghae’s representative dishes, such as wild vegetable bibimbap and mulhoe (cold raw fish soup), and includes 76 restaurants certified for hygiene and safety under the top, model, and hygiene-grade restaurant system.



The map features intuitive design and systematic layout, making it easy to check restaurant information. It aims to support both citizens and tourists in enjoying local food with confidence. The map is available at major tourist spots such as the Tourist Information Center, Cheongok Golden Bat Cave, and Mangsang Auto Camping Resort. It is also distributed at transportation hubs, including terminals, train stations, and highway rest areas, making it easily accessible for tourists. A total of 3,000 copies have been distributed, and a mobile guide using QR codes has been installed, allowing people to easily access restaurant information via smartphones.


 Donghae expects the taste map to increase interest in local food culture, contribute to the promotion of safe food options, and activate the restaurant industry, which will positively impact the local economy.
